■
Trasmissione
Sistema
decentralizzato
instabus
EIB
è un sistema di controllo degli edifici decentralizzato, pilotato da
eventi con trasmissione dati seriale per le funzioni operative di
controllo, monitoraggio e segnalazione. Tramite una linea di
trasmissione comune, il bus, tutti gli apparecchi bus collegati possono
scambiarsi informazioni. La trasmissione dati avviene in modo seriale
secondo regole stabilite: il protocollo di trasmissione bus.
Il telegramma
Le informazioni da
trasmettere sono organizzate nel cosiddetto “telegramma” ed inviate via
bus da un apparecchio (il “mittente”) ad uno o più apparecchi (il/i
“destinatario/i”). Ogni destinatario conferma la ricezione del
telegramma; se ciò non avviene l’invio del telegramma viene ripetuto
(fino a tre volte). Se la ricezione del telegramma non viene confermata
la procedura di invio viene interrotta e l’errore viene registrato nella
memoria del trasmettitore. La trasmissione con
instabus EIB non è separata galvanicamente poiché la tensione
di alimentazione degli apparecchi bus (24 V DC) viene trasmessa
contemporaneamente. I telegrammi vengono modulati su questa tensione
continua; uno zero logico viene trasmesso come impulso mentre l’assenza
di impulsi viene interpretata come un 1 logico. I singoli dati dei
telegrammi vengono trasmessi in modo asincrono. La trasmissione viene
comunque sincronizzata grazie ai bit di avvio e stop.
Accesso al bus
L'accesso al bus come mezzo di comunicazione fisico comune per
trasmissione asincrona deve essere comunque regolato in modo chiaro.
instabus EIB impiega a questo scopo il protocollo CSMA/CA (Carrier
Sense Multiple Access/Collision Avoidance); si tratta di un metodo
sicuro di accesso casuale al bus esente da collisioni senza peraltro
diminuire la portata dei dati sul bus. Tutti gli apparecchi sono
permanentemente in ascolto del bus; se un apparecchio bus vuole inviare
un telegramma deve dapprima controllare che nessun altro apparecchio
stia già trasmettendo (Carrier Sense). Se il bus è libero ogni
apparecchio collegato può iniziare la procedura di invio (Multiple
Access). Se due apparecchi iniziano a trasmettere contemporaneamente
prevale l'apparecchio che ha priorità più alta (Collision
Avoidance) mentre l’altro apparecchio interrompe la procedura per
riavviarla successivamente. Se entrambi gli apparecchi hanno la stessa
priorità, prevale quello con indirizzo fisico inferiore.
|